Program Structure
The MSc in Project Management (Top up) program typically consists of a combination of core modules, elective courses, and a final project or dissertation. Students will delve deep into topics such as project planning, risk management, stakeholder engagement, and more.
| Module |
Description |
| Strategic Project Management |
Focuses on aligning project objectives with overall business goals |
| Project Risk Management |
Explores strategies for identifying, assessing, and mitigating project risks |
| Project Leadership |
Enhances leadership skills for effective project management |
